Every human has rights : a photographic declaration for kids  Cover Image Book Book

Every human has rights : a photographic declaration for kids / foreword by Mary Robinson.

Summary:

Based on the thirty rights listed in the "United Nations Universal Declaration of Human Rights," explores the basic freedoms of human beings, especially children, with examples of how these rights have been implemented around the world.
